September 6: Sunday — The Example of Jesus

Bible Focus

  • 2 Corinthians 8:1–15
  • 2 Corinthians 8:9
  • Philippians 2:7–8
  • John 17:5
  • Luke 9:58

Summary

  • The Corinthian believers had already promised to help poor Christians in Judea, and Paul now urged them to complete what they had started.
  • Paul first pointed to the Macedonian believers, who gave generously even though they were very poor.
  • Their generosity showed that having little does not prevent us from giving when love moves our hearts.
  • Paul then pointed to Jesus, whose giving was far greater than any human gift.
  • Jesus was rich in heaven, sharing the heavenly glory He had with the Father before coming to this world.
  • He became poor for our sake, leaving heavenly glory and taking the form of a servant among us.
  • Jesus humbled Himself even to death on the cross, so that we could receive the riches of salvation.
  • His example teaches us that Christian giving is not merely about money, but about giving ourselves in love for God and others.
